Abstract

We performed a numerical study to observe the influence of the Marangoni convection and external temperature gradient on the temperature and oxygen impurities fluctuations near the solid liquid interface. For this purpose, a 3D numerical model, using the STHAMAS3D software, has been developed for a Cz configuration for 200mm silicon crystals growth. We analyzed the temperature and oxygen impurities fluctuations in a monitor point situated below the solidification interface in two cases: with and without Marangoni convection taken into consideration. Also, we studied the influence of three profiles of the external temperature gradient on the temperature and oxygen fluctuations. Both studies revealed that there is a small dependence of the temperature distribution in the melt near the interface both on the Marangoni convection and on the temperature gradient. The O concentration is more uniformly distributed in the melt if the effects of the Marangoni convection are present and it has a higher value if a smaller external temperature gradient is used.
